Does Alamo use E-ZPass for tolls in Norfolk?
Yes, Alamo rental vehicles in Norfolk come equipped with an electronic toll device compatible with Virginia's E-ZPass system, since cash toll booths are rare in the area.
When you pick up your Alamo vehicle in Norfolk, you have two options for handling tolls:
- Purchase an unlimited toll package at the counter, typically priced between US$11 and US$25 per day depending on the location and vehicle class
- Decline the package and pay per use, in which case Alamo will charge the actual toll amount plus an administrative processing fee to your credit card after the rental ends
Key toll roads you may encounter near Norfolk include the Chesapeake Expressway (US$4.00 for a standard 2-axle car over 16 miles) and the Pocahontas Parkway (US$4.85 for 2-axle vehicles). If you drive toward Northern Virginia, the I-66, I-495, I-95, and I-395 Express Lanes use dynamic pricing that fluctuates with traffic.
Note that toll charges are sometimes billed days or even weeks after you return the vehicle, as toll agencies process invoices in batches. Review your rental agreement carefully before signing so you understand which program applies to your Norfolk rental.
What documents do I need to pick up my Alamo car in Norfolk?
To collect your Alamo rental in Norfolk, you must bring the following physical documents to the counter:
- A valid, original driver's license in the main driver's name
- A major credit card with the driver's name printed on the physical card, for the security deposit hold
- A passport or valid government-issued photo ID
- Your booking confirmation or printed voucher
- Round-trip flight or cruise tickets (required for visitors from outside the United States)
If your driver's license is not in English and does not use a Latin (Roman) alphabet, such as Arabic, Chinese, Japanese, or Cyrillic script, an International Driving Permit (IDP) is mandatory alongside your original license. For licenses in English or a Roman alphabet, an IDP is recommended but not strictly required.
All documents must be physical originals. Digital copies shown on a phone or tablet are not accepted at the Alamo counter in Norfolk. A name mismatch between your license, passport, and credit card is one of the most common reasons for delays at pick-up, so verify that all names match before you travel.
What credit card do I need for the Alamo deposit in Norfolk?
Yes, a physical major credit card is required at the Alamo counter in Norfolk to cover the security deposit hold.
The card must be in the main driver's name with the driver's name printed on the card. Debit cards, prepaid cards, and virtual or single-use card numbers are not accepted for the deposit, even if you have already prepaid your booking.
For a standard vehicle at a U.S. location like Norfolk, Alamo typically places a hold of approximately US$300 to US$400 on your credit card. This is a temporary authorization, not a charge, but it reduces your available credit until your bank releases it after the rental ends. Banks can take up to 15 business days to post the release.
Before traveling to Norfolk, it is a good idea to:
- Notify your bank of international or out-of-state travel to prevent fraud blocks
- Confirm you have enough available credit to cover both the hold and any expected charges
- Bring a backup credit card in your own name in case your primary card is declined

What is the minimum age to rent an Alamo car in Norfolk?
The minimum age to rent an Alamo car in Norfolk without a young-renter surcharge is 25. Drivers aged 21 to 24 can rent but will be charged an additional daily underage fee at the counter.
At Alamo in Norfolk, the young-renter surcharge is US$15 per day plus applicable taxes. This fee is paid directly at the counter and is not included in your prepaid rate.
Drivers under 25 are also restricted from renting certain vehicle classes. Categories such as full-size SUVs, premium, luxury, convertibles, minivans, and vans are generally limited to renters aged 25 and older. Compact, economy, and intermediate vehicles are typically available to younger drivers.
Additional requirements that apply regardless of age:
- A valid driver's license in good standing
- A major credit card in the main driver's name for the security deposit
- An International Driving Permit if the license uses a non-Latin alphabet
Virginia is not one of the states (like New York or Michigan) that requires rental companies to serve drivers aged 18 and older, so the standard Alamo policy applies in Norfolk.
How does the fuel policy work for Alamo rentals in Norfolk?
Alamo uses a Full-to-Full fuel policy for rentals in Norfolk, meaning you receive the car with a full tank and must return it full to avoid extra charges.
At pick-up, check the fuel gauge with the Alamo agent and confirm the starting level is recorded on the rental agreement. Take a photo of the dashboard showing both the odometer and the fuel gauge before leaving the Norfolk location.
When returning your Alamo vehicle in Norfolk, refuel within approximately 10 miles or 15 kilometers of the return location so the gauge does not drop below full before you arrive. Keep your final fuel receipt showing the date, time, and station address.
If you return the car below the recorded starting level, Alamo may charge:
- A fuel shortfall at the partner's refueling rate, which is typically higher than the retail pump price
- A refueling service or administrative handling fee
For after-hours returns in Norfolk, leave the fuel receipt in the key envelope and keep a photo of the full gauge on your phone as evidence. Returning the tank full is always the most cost-effective option.

What happens if I miss a toll on my Alamo rental in Norfolk?
If you drive through a toll road near Norfolk without paying or enrolling in a toll program, the Virginia Department of Transportation will issue a violation notice by mail to the registered owner of the vehicle, which in this case is Alamo.
Alamo will then pass the violation charge on to you, typically along with an administrative processing fee. These charges can appear on your credit card days or even weeks after you have returned the vehicle, because toll agencies process invoices in batches.
To avoid this situation on your Norfolk rental, you have a few options at the Alamo counter:
- Enroll in the unlimited toll package (approximately US$11 to US$25 per day) so all tolls are handled automatically
- Decline the package and pay tolls manually at booths where cash is accepted, though cash lanes are increasingly rare in Virginia
- Purchase your own E-ZPass transponder before your trip if you plan to drive frequently on toll roads in the Norfolk area or beyond
If you believe a toll charge posted to your account after returning your Alamo vehicle in Norfolk is incorrect, gather your booking confirmation, rental agreement, and any toll receipts, then contact support for assistance reviewing the charge.

What insurance options are available for my Alamo rental in Norfolk?
When renting with Alamo in Norfolk, your booking confirmation will show which protections are included in your rate. The two main coverages to understand are CDW/LDW and third-party liability.
CDW (Collision Damage Waiver) or LDW (Loss Damage Waiver) reduces your financial liability for damage to the Alamo vehicle itself, including collision, theft, and vandalism. A deductible may apply unless your confirmation explicitly states zero deductible. CDW/LDW does not cover damage you cause to other vehicles or people.
Third-party liability (LIS/SLI/ALI) covers bodily injury and property damage you may cause to others while driving the Alamo rental in Norfolk. In Virginia, not all rental locations are required by state law to include minimum liability coverage, so it is strongly recommended to add supplemental liability insurance to your booking.
Common exclusions to be aware of:
- Tires, wheels, undercarriage, and roof damage are often not covered by standard CDW/LDW
- Prohibited use such as off-road driving, DUI, or unauthorized drivers voids coverage
- Only drivers named on the Alamo rental agreement in Norfolk are protected
Review your rate details carefully before picking up in Norfolk to confirm which coverages are active and what deductibles apply.
